Just move the mod to the top in the launcher, and everything will work
Just to clarify — this mod can’t cause crashes, because it’s literally just a cloud texture. It doesn’t modify scripts, engine behavior, or anything critical — only visual sky textures.
As for the fact that you can’t disable it:
That’s most likely because you’re also using my other mod, GI Texture vegetation mod by ARTstuff. In that mod, I’ve included True Gothic Skies as a required dependency, so the launcher will always ask for it to be active — that’s by design. It ensures the clouds match the overall visual style of the vegetation.
